MOVIE: EWE OJU OMI
Produced by: Laide Bakare
Directed by: Niji Akanni
Starring: Olumide Bakare, Clarion Chukwurah, Femi Brainard, Laide Bakare

Interesting film about the dirty game of Nigerian Politics. Chief Kuti and Tunde Adeniyi are bitter political opponents both contesting for the same public position. Chief Kuti sends thugs to beat up Tunde Adeniyi and the thugs report back to Chief Kuti that Tunde Adeniyi is dead. Chief Kuti rebukes the thugs stating that he did not tell them to kill him, that he only asked them to beat him.

In the wake of the death of Tunde Adeniyi, his political party members persuades his younger brother, Sanda to step in his place and contest so that people who supported Tunde would still vote for him. Sanda, angered by the killing of his brother, agrees to step in and carry on the fight to defeat Chief Kuti in the election. Unfortunately, Sanda's girlfriend, Iyabo happens to be Chief Kuti's daughter. On stepping into his brother's shoes, he immediately jilts Iyabo calling her a murderer's daughter and leaving the poor heart-broken girl, who is obviously in love, to weep all night. Iyabo tells her mother that she regrets being Chief Kuti's daughter and after discovering that she is pregnant, goes on to angrily challenge her father for being a murderer and affirms her support for Sanda in the election, despite the fact that he has jilted her.

Chief Kuti gets seriously taunted for being a murderer by the people. His political party drops him as the candidate after realising that he'd never win because he has been branded a murderer by the masses. Even his wife parks out of the house after being publicly derided many times as the wife of a murderer. The whole frustration makes Chief Kuti to commit suicide.

In the wake of this, Iyabo's mother disguises and visits Sanda in the middle of the night to inform him of his neglected girlfriend Iyabo's pregnancy and her own husband's death. Sanda becomes sober on hearing this and goes to visit Iyabo where the truth is revealed that his brother Tunde Adeniyi is not dead. He merely capitalized on Chief Kuti's act of thuggery, pretended to be dead and absconded the town to draw sympathy from the masses and bring victory to their party. Turns out it was a political tactic.

Sanda apologises to Iyabo for his part in the plot and promises to confess this to the press, disengage from the scheming political party and come back to start a new life with Iyabo and his unborn child.

He never got this because as soon as he finishes confessing to the press and tries to escape, his brother and other political party members get on his heels and kill him.

No sexually graphic/voodoo scenec but there are violent scenes.

Best Actor in this film - Laide Bakare (Iyabo), playing the role of a heart-broken girl who loved and lost.

MOVIE: PASSION AND PAIN
Directed by: Tarila Thompson
Produced by: Elochukwu Anigbogu
Starring: Genevieve Nnaji, Ramsey Nouah, Emeka Ike
Featuring: Desmond Elliot, Uche Iwuji

If you have zero tolerance for what we call "Mumu"(fool) then don't watch this film or you might break your TV screen while trying to reach for someone's head.
Passion & Pain is the story of two young and hopeful lovers - Damian(Emeka Ike) and Maureen(Genevieve Nnaji) who are both freshers in the University. Damian is from a lowly poor family but Maureen doesn't care about that as they are both truly in love.

Francis is the spoilt, rich love-vendor friend of Ola's boyfriend. Ola and Maureen are roommates. Francis the rich love-vendor spots Maureen, takes interest in her and after a few player tricks, Maureen falls despite all Damian's efforts to keep her away. Damian's loss of the love of his life affects him badly and he turns to smoking & drinking to console himself.

Then Francis decides to move abroad to continue his studies and forgets about Maureen. She goes back to Damian to beg for forgiveness and he accepts her painfully.
A new life begins for Damian and Maureen together, luck smiles on him and he gets a good job after graduation and introduces Maureen to his father as his future wife.

But Francis returns home with a wayward Afro-American wife and runs into Maureen at a supermarket one day. Francis gets back to his old tricks and Maureen falls yet again, betraying Damian once more.
What? Not again! Much worse this time, Maureen gets pregnant and Francis blanks off again, even when Maureen informs him of her pregnancy!
Here comes the mumu Damian - no, Maureen does not go back to beg him like before, but his 'mumu' acts are there for you to find out in this movie,

Best Actor in this film: Emeka Ike, the mumu himself.

MOVIE: ARK OF GOD
Produced by: Mike Bamiloye
Directed by: Mike Bamiloye, Sunday Ogunyemi

Starring: Mike Bamiloye, Stephen Bamiloye, Israel Ore-Adewole, Gloria Bamiloye.

This is about a courageous Christian whose kidnap and boldness in the face of adversity became instrumental to the reunion between his father and grandfather.

The king of Iremoje village laid critically ill and about to die. The most powerful herbalist in Iremoje village sent out some boys to the city to kidnap a young boy to kill for some rituals to heal the dying king.

A young schoolboy, Deola was kidnapped and he used the Bible verses he learnt from his Mum to scare the herbalist, King and their cohorts. The herbalists believed his Bible citations to be fetish incantations and thought him to be a powerful child. Well he is, but not the kind of power they thought.

Meanwhile, his parents had been seriously fasting and praying for his return and going round all police stations looking for him.
They became afraid to kill him for the rituals and decided to return him to where he was kidnapped, but the King refuses saying his heart does not want him to go yet. He asked the boy to be called to his presence and told him about his illness hoping that he would help since all else had failed. The boys asked if the King had offended anyone or placed a curse on anyone. Turned out the King had indeed offended and placed a curse on his only son, Prince Obadepo. The boy advised the King that he should look for the Prince to pray for him and he'd be healed. This annoyed the King who had sworn never to forgive the Prince and he angrily asked the boy to be taken away from his presence.

Prince Obadepo, on the other side, had also been warned by his Pastor to forgive his father & reconcile with him to have his prayer answered about his lost son. He reluctantly did this after so much persuasion only to find his lost son there with his father.

There are two versions of this film. The English and the Yoruba version titled 'Apoti Eri'.
No sexually graphic scenes. There are some voodoo scenes and one other which might be considered a bit violent.

Best Actor in this film: Stephen Bamiloye, I loved that boy in the movie! He was brilliant.

MOVIE: BLOOD ON THE ALTAR
Produced by: Mike Bamiloye
Directed by: Mike Bamiloye, Elvon Jarrett
Starring: Abel Martins, Gloria Bamiloye, Elvon Jarrett, Elizabeth-Ore Adewole

This is a Christian film from Mount Zion Ministries. It's the story of a powerful and widely-known minister of God, Rev. Atilade Hosea who fell into sin by having a secret extra-marital affair with his secretary, Tumi - a divorced woman. This marked the beginning of chaos for him because the lady became pregnant leaving them with no choice but to agree to abort the baby. Reverend gave Tumi money for the abortion and she headed off for another town (probably to avoid being recognised as the popular Reverend's secretary?) to have the abortion, staying the night with her friend, Yetunde. The abortion however did not go right as she was rushed back to the hospital not long after she got home.

Clement,Tumi's divorced husband, meanwhile set out to look for his wife in a bid to reconcile with her after he became born-again. He located the Pastor's office and coincidentally, Clement was with the Pastor and his wife when her friend came to call them to rush to the hospital about Tumi's critical condition. The poor man never got the chance to reconcile with his wife as she was already dead by the time they got to the hospital.
Tumi, however, left behind a letter and her diary in her friend's house. Yetunde read through and discovered the truth about the affair, the pregnancy and abortion. She began to use the evidence to blackmail and constantly haunt the Pastor for money.

A minister of God in another town received direction from God about the evil acts of the Pastor and went on an investigative assignment where he met Yetunde, preached to her and converted her from her bad ways of blackmailing and made her return all the money she collected. The duo of the Pastor and Yetunde collaborated to expose the Pastor's acts leading the story to an unexpected and tragic end.

This movie is in 4 Parts! But well worth the length. No violent, sexually graphic, voodoo or ritual scenes.

Best Actor in this film: I have to give it to Gloria Bamiloye who acted as Mrs Hosea, the beautiful wife of the Reverend who faced distress throughout the story.

MOVIE: BUTTERFLY

Reviewer's Rating: 7/10
Starring: Ramsey Nouah, Genevieve Nnaji, Clem Ohameze

Another romance flick with its first few scenes reminiscent of Ramsey Nouah's usual 'Valentino' playboy style - using and dumping girls. Felix, as Ramsey Nouah is called in this movie, gets the help of his cousin, Florence who arranges girls for him. But meeting Chelsea (Genevieve Nnaji) changes all that as Ramsey falls head-over-heels in love with her and decides to change his ways to dedicate himself to and marry Chelsea, thinking he has found his wife! Felix does everything possible to get Chelsea but she keeps turning him down rudely. The ultimate love-vendor Felix now becomes humiliated. It turns out Chelsea is interested in another man, Ray (Clem Ohameze) who is more engrossed in his work and has no time for her.

So Felix wants Chelsea but Chelsea wants Ray. Well, someone ends up getting h** heart's desire.
The twist in this story is that it doesn't end in the way other cassanova-style flicks end.

Best Actor in this film: is definitely Ramsey Nouah. Watch the very last scene and see how he turns to a jellyfish dundee while Chelsea introduces him to Ray, her lover. Apart from the fact that the 'Mr Lover Lover' role always suits him well in movies, he also did a good job in interpreting this role the more.

No violent scenes, No sexually graphic scenes and no voodoo/rituals scene. Just your average romantic movie.

People who enjoyed this movie may also enjoy Valentino, Playboy and Power of Love.
